The Master Mobile Astronomical System. Optical Observations of Gamma-Ray Bursts
Authors:V M Lipunov  V G Kornilov  A V Krylov  G V Borisov  D A Kuvshinov  A A Belinski  E S Gorbovskoy  G A Antipov  N V Tyurina  V M Vitrischak  S A Potanin  M V Kuznetsov
Institution:(1) P. K. Shternberg State Astronomical Institute, Russia;(2) Physics Faculty, Moscow State University, Russia
Abstract:The operating principles of the telescope-robot system MASTER (Mobile Astronomical System of Telescopes-Robots, http://observ.pereplet.ru), designed to search for fast transient phenomena in the optical range, are described. The robot-telescope includes the following: a Richter-Slefogt telescope with D=355 mm, F/D=2.4, a Richter-Slefogt telescope with D=200 mm, F/D=2.4, a Flugge telescope with D=280 mm, F/D=2.5, a TV camera with a field of 20x40 degrees, and three CCD cameras. A German mount with a slew rate of 8 deg/s is used. MASTER obtains images down to 19m in a field of 6 square degrees in a 1.5 minute exposure. We present some observations of the optical afterglow of cosmic gamma-ray bursts. MASTER was the first system in Europe to record optical emission from GRB030329.__________Translated from Astrofizika, Vol. 48, No. 3, pp. 463–475 (August 2005).
